Abstract

One of the companies that carries out human resource management is BPJS Ketenagakerjaan (Employment Social Security Administering Agency) which is a public program that provides protection for workers to overcome certain socio-economic risks and its implementation uses social insurance mechanisms as a State institution that operates in the insurance sector. social BPJS Ketenagakerjaan, formerly known as PT Jamsostek (Persero), is the implementer of the labor social security law. The results of this research are as follows: Organizational Culture has a positive and significant effect on Organizational Commitment with a value of 0.431 and a sig of 0.000. Teamwork has a positive and significant effect on Organizational Culture with a value of 0.347 and sig 0.001. Teamwork has a positive and significant effect on Organizational Commitment with a value of 0.380 and sig 0.001. Organizational Citizenship Behavior has a positive and significant effect on Organizational Culture with a value of 0.573 and a sig of 0.000. Organizational Citizenship Behavior has a positive and significant effect on Organizational Commitment with a value of 0.113 and a sig of 0.204. Teamwork has a positive and significant indirect effect on Organizational Commitment through Organizational Culture with a value of 0.150 and a sig of 0.007. Organizational Citizenship Behavior has a positive and significant indirect effect on Organizational Commitment through Organizational Culture with a value of 0.247 and a sig of 0.000.
